The Effect of the Interplay of Gender and Ethnicity on Teachers Judgements: Does the School Subject Matter?
Two experimental studies investigated the disadvantages faced by female ethnic minority students when they are judged by pre- and inservice teachers. The results suggest that (preservice) teachers' judgments were affected by the judgment dimension. Study 1 revealed that teachers apply gender st...
